Ice climbing in the south is a rare moment in time. I wanted to be prepared! I set out to make my own Ice climbing ice axes. I failed the first time, with weak dimensions and low quality metal. After much research the second set of picks worked great. Most people leave making an ice axe to the professionals at grivel or petzl. Not me! In this tutorial I show you how I made an Ice Axe from start to finish. I show you what metal to use, how thick the picks need to be and most importantly, avoiding all the mistakes I made while making your own ice axe. Enjoy & Thanks for watching.
